Problema Solution
Karen sold 450 copies of her magazine for $5 each. If the buyer subscribed to her magazine, then they received a 20 percent discount on their purchase. There were 50 less than three times the amount of people who bought the magazine but did not subscribe. If she earned $2125, how many people subscribed to her magazine?

let 'x' represent the number of people who subscribed to the magazine, then '3x-50' represents the number of people who bought the magazine without a subscription
cost for subscribers:
5 - 0.2*5 = 4.
2125 = 4x + 5(3x-50)
solving for 'x' we have x=125
3*125 - 50 = 325
125 people have subscribed to Karen's magazine
